- The distance between Chihuahua, Mexico and Azul, Argentina is approximately 8,727 km or 5,423 mi.
- To reach Chihuahua in this distance one would set out from Azul bearing 319.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Chihuahua bearing 323.8° or NW .
- Chihuahua has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Azul has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Chihuahua is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Azul is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 3.8 °C (6.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.5 °C (4.5°F) more in Chihuahua.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 653.3 mm (25.7 in) less which is equivalent to 653.3 l/m² (16.03 US gal/ft²) or 6,533,000 l/ha (698,421 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.7° higher in Chihuahua than in Azul.
- Relative humidity levels are 31.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.5°C (6.3°F) lower.
